We bring you a compact overview of the 10 best beaches for those who enjoy yachting. Gregor Balažic, creator of the BeachRex project, worked hard to scrutinise and compare more than a thousand Croatian beaches

Gregor Balažic began his exploration of Mediterranean beaches with a thorough plan and a clear vision. Its results include an extensive collection of imagery (50,000 photographs, 2,500 videos and many 3D spherical shots), and more than 500,000 location-specific details on beach type, infrastructure, facilities and services offered. The data is currently available at www.beachrex.com. This cutting edge website allows users to easily search beaches all over Croatia, from Istria, Kvarner and Dalmatia to Dubrovnik, with special emphasis on the Croatian islands.

Each beach study features high-quality photographs, video footage and 3D spherical imagery that enables the viewer to see it from every perspective. Furthermore, there is useful information on car parking facilities, accessing the beach, navigation to and travel time to the beach, water temperature and weather forecast. BeachRex even explains what conditions you can expect to find at the beaches. For example, sand or stones, the availability of natural shade, the ambience (family beach, explorer beach, party beach), restaurants, available sports facilities, regular entertainment and whether or not accommodation is available. Enthusiastic users can add their own comments and rate the beach. Soon, there will be 1,500 French, Spanish and Italian beaches presented.

Plaza Jezero Duba Peljeska
Jezero, Duba Pelješka

Pebble beach, for adventurers, with no infrastructure, low occupancy, easily accessible, and 1,000 meters away from a parking lot.

Plaza Cista Kolan Pag
Čista, Kolan, Island of Pag (cover photo)

Pebble beach, for families, with basic infrastructure, average occupancy, easily accessible, 50 meters from a large parking lot, one restaurant.

Plaza Murvica Brac
Murvica, Murvica, Island of Brač

Pebble beach, for families, with basic infrastructure, high occupancy, mid-level accessibility, there is a parking lot 200 meters away, a beach bar and it is one of the most romantic beaches on the Adriatic.

Plaza Stiniva Vis
Stiniva, Marinje Zemlje, Island of Vis

Rocky beach, for adventurers, basic infrastructure, average occupancy, but it is not easily accessible, 500 meters from a parking lot, with a 125 metre height difference between the parking lot and the beach.

Plaza Jelena Bol Brac
Jelena, Bol, Island of Brač

Pebble beach, for adventurers, with no infrastructure, average occupancy, easily accessible and 100 meters away from a parking lot.

Plaza Konopjik Pucisca Brac
Konopjik, Pučišća, Island of Brač

Rocky beach, for adventurers, with no infrastructure, low occupancy and can only be reached by boat.

Plaza Mala Stiniva Jelsa Hvar
Mala Stiniva, Jelsa, Island of Hvar

Pebble beach, for families, with basic infrastructure, average occupancy, easily accessible, there is a parking lot 100 meters away from the beach.

Plaza Malo Borce Milna Hvar
Malo Borče, Milna, Island of Hvar

Pebble beach, for adventurers, with no infrastructure, low occupancy, mid to complicated level of accessibility, more than 1,000 m away from the parking lot, and 50-metre height difference between the parking lot and the beach.

Plaza Rasoha Blato Korcula
Rasoha, Blato, Island of Korčula

Rocky beach, for families, basic infrastructure and average occupancy, 100 meters away from a parking lot, easily accessible.

Plaza Veliki Pokrvenik Hvar
Veliki Pokrvenik, Pokrivenik, Island of Hvar

Pebble beach, for families, with basic infrastructure, average occupancy and easily accessible, just 100 meters from a parking lot.
